A hundred years from now people are going to be absolutely flabbergasted how we just piped gas everywhere all the time. Electricity allows for so many more automatic safeguards.

Electrical is inadequate power delivery-wise and requires completely different cookware to the point that it's a different cuisine. For example to replicate a gas burner you have to have above 15KW continious power. Good luck wiring that into your apartment, or feeding this with local solar. Or even finding an induction stovetop that won't melt its insides in a year or two at a measly 5KW.

https://www.impulselabs.com/ achieves this by storing energy in a battery. 120V15A in to charge, 10kW out for short durations. I don't have one, but it's an interesting concept.

That said, I don't know what's better, a massive lithium battery in the kitchen that can be set into thermal runaway, or a gas line.

But also, most Japanese styles of cooking doesn't need those levels of power anyway. 4-5kW induction hobs running on a proper 240V outlet or whatever the Japanese industrial equivalent is are usually plenty for most professional cooking.

Earlier quoted context omitted.

NHK TV is showing extensive damage including fallen smokestacks at Nippon Paper Factory facility, bridge road separation, fallen bridge lane, road cracks, fire, water coming out of drainage etc. It was a huge earthquake and will take some time to assess the damage.

There is a collapsed roof of a shopping centre as well in Kumamoto. The Aeon Mall.

That mall was also damaged in a similar earthquake that happened in 2016.
